    First of all, I think that when you are faced with other people's bad evaluations of you, you will definitely have unhappy emotions no more or less, but you should stabilize your emotions first and listen to other people's opinions first. On the one hand, you humbly listen to the other person's bad evaluation of you, you can see if there is something wrong with you in this regard, and then conduct a self-examination. If you feel that there is a problem after reviewing what others say, then you must find a way to improve this problem and make yourself a better person.

    If what he says is just something that doesn't exist, then you can just say it. Don't take it to heart and affect your mood, and you will treat what he says as if you haven't heard anything. If you feel that his evaluation makes you feel that this is a slander, then you can tell him directly, ask him to explain why he gave you such an evaluation, what is the reason, if he can't say it, let him apologize and retract this false evaluation.

    However, I think in today's society, this kind of talk about my bad words, I will complain about you, these things are still common, we should look away a little, don't care too much, after all, what everyone usually says is just talking, maybe you did a little bad at that time, or you were really a little unbearable for him at that time, or he really had a little misunderstanding, but these are just small problems, you but if we really take these trivial things in life very seriously, then you will have a very hard time, There will be a lot less joy in your life. Therefore, when dealing with other people's bad evaluations of you, we still uphold the principle of correcting if there is something and encouraging you if there is none.
